Overview

Pilar Santisteban is affiliated with the Spanish National Research Council in Spain. Their research spans multiple fields within biochemistry, genetics, and molecular biology, with a focus that also intersects medicine. The scientist has contributed significantly to molecular biology, endocrinology, diabetes and metabolism, genetics, cell biology, and cancer research.

The scientist's main research topics incorporate thyroid cancer diagnosis and treatment, RNA research and splicing, Hippo pathway signaling and YAP/TAZ, cancer-related molecular mechanisms, Wnt/β-catenin signaling in development and cancer, RNA regulation and disease, and fibroblast growth factor research.

Their recent publications include the following papers:

  • ADAR1-mediated RNA editing is a novel oncogenic process in thyroid cancer and regulates miR-200 activity (2020, Oncogene)
  • Gene network transitions in embryos depend upon interactions between a pioneer transcription factor and core histones (2020, Nature Genetics)
  • Focal adhesion kinase-YAP signaling axis drives drug-tolerant persister cells and residual disease in lung cancer (2024, Nature Communications)
  • BRAF V600E Status Sharply Differentiates Lymph Node Metastasis-associated Mortality Risk in Papillary Thyroid Cancer (2021, The Journal of Clinical Endocrinology & Metabolism)
  • An ADAR1-dependent RNA editing event in the cyclin-dependent kinase CDK13 promotes thyroid cancer hallmarks (2021, Molecular Cancer)

Frequent co-authors include Celia Fernández-Méndez, Garcilaso Riesco-Eizaguirre, Julia Ramírez-Moya, Carlos Carrasco-López, and Antonio De la Vieja.

Pilar Santisteban has published regularly in venues such as Thyroid, Endocrine Abstracts, Faculty Opinions - Post-Publication Peer Review of the Biomedical Literature, Endocrine Related Cancer, and Cancers.
